Oktaha is 8-2 against Haskell since January of 2018 and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Thursday. The Oktaha Tigers will welcome the Haskell Haymakers at 3:00 p.m.
Oktaha is probably headed into the game with a chip on their shoulder considering Calera just ended the team's three-game winning streak on Tuesday. They came up short against the Bulldogs, falling 67-41. While losing is never fun, the Tigers can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Oklahoma basketball rankings (they are ranked 111th, while the Bulldogs are ranked 27th).
Meanwhile, win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Haskell). They breezed by Mounds to the tune of 70-41 on Tuesday.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Haymakers.
Haskell's victory bumped their record up to 4-8. As for Oktaha, their defeat ended a five-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 10-5.
Everything came up roses for Oktaha against Haskell when the teams last played on January 7th, as the team secured a 69-26 win. Will Oktaha repeat their success, or does Haskell have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
